从2000年到2016年,太阳能光伏的部署以年均44%的复合速度增长,从0.8吉瓦(GW)增长到291吉瓦。太阳能光伏组件的“学习率”很高,在18%到22%之间,这取决于所分析的时间段。随着部署的快速增长,从2009年底到2016年,模块价格下降了80-85%。2010年至2016年,全球公用事业规模的太阳能光伏项目的加权平均总安装成本和平均电价(LCOE)分别下降了65%和67%。

Solar PV deployment has grown at an annual average compound rate of 44% between 2000 and 2016, from 0.8 gigawatts (GW) to 291 GW. Solar PV modules have high “learning rates” of between 18% and 22% depending on the period analysed. With the rapid growth in deployment, module prices have declined by around 80–85% between the end of 2009 and 2016. Between 2010 and 2016, the global weighted average total installed cost and the levelised cost of electricity (LCOE) of utility-scale solar PV projects fell by 65% and 67% respectively.
